About

Mr. Kuso Cafe is a Taiwanese restaurant located in Temple City, California. The restaurant offers a wide selection of unique dishes, from noodle and rice-based dishes to specialty drinks. Each dish is made fresh with a variety of ingredients, including fish, meat, and vegetables. Customers can also order take-out or delivery. The restaurant also offers catering for special events. At Mr. Kuso Cafe, customers can enjoy a unique Taiwanese dining experience.

Amazing Taiwanese food, most things are very reasonably priced, especially after the inflation. The boba drinks are delicious with the best boba I’ve ever had, prices are cheap compared to others. The service was fast and the workers were really polite and helpful. Would go again soon!

Definitely my favorite Taiwanese restaurant. Love their popcorn chicken. I have had many popcorn chicken in the SG valley area (pp pop, the Taiwaese restaurant in Arcadia, from Taiwanese drink place etc) and this is definitely the best. Authentic Taiwanese food. Their Ma Po tofu rice, pork chop rice, chicken cartilage, Taiwanese sausage... Everything is delicious. Highly recommend. They get very busy so call or order online.

This is my go to place when I’m craving Taiwanese snacks. Good portions with fair prices. Here are my go to: 1. Braised pork rice ($7.50) 2. Taiwanese Gua bao ($4.50) 3. Fried stinky tofu ($6.50) 4. Popcorn chicken ($5.99) 5. Fried fish cake ($5.50) Something I would NOT recommend: Pig intestine - they are pretty gamy Drinks - great price (under $4) but mostly watered down, boba wasn’t chewy too Overall, it’s a good place for Taiwanese snacks. It’s authentic!
